### Connection pooling (Tarnwell DB tier)

Each service holds a Finchpool instance capped at 20 connections; the database accepts 400 total, so audit caps before adding replicas. Idle connections recycle after 300 seconds. Exhaustion manifests as checkout timeouts, not errors. Sizing rationale, tuning history, and the capacity worksheet are maintained here:

operations page: https://jenkins.zemvarcloud.local/job/merge_requests/repo/build/73930b4b30f0a8ed

Welcome to Quillbrook Studios! A heads-up on holiday-period hours: between 24 December and 2 January the Ashmere Lane building runs a skeleton schedule, open 09:00–15:00 only, and the café is shut entirely (stock the biscuit drawer accordingly). Reception is unstaffed, so the main doors stay locked and you'll need to let yourself in via the side entrance on Pelter Street. Facilities asks that you sign the paper register just inside. To get through the side entrance during this period, use the door code below.

door code, yagap-bahof: bdg-O-05

# Rate Limit Approvals

All changes to rate limiting in the Gatekept internal API gateway require written approval before merge. This includes per-tenant quotas, burst multipliers, and any edits to the shared limiter config in `gateway/limits.yaml`. New team members: never hotfix limits directly in production, even during incidents — raised limits have cascaded into datastore overload twice. Open a change request and obtain sign-off from the approver named below.

account owner for bawip-fajeg: Ralix Oliwyn